I've had some problems using the 7elite version:

- Permission/Locking errors: When using Visual Studio 2008 to compile programs, after testing two or three times it begins running into permission/locking issues where it is unable to create a new solution for my code. I've also just ran into another issue where I was trying to download a file from Firefox. When I clicked to download a file (mIRC.com) to my personal folder, it comes up and says it is unable to write to this directory or it is locked. Strangely, the file was written to the download directory, yet, it's locked and I can't delete it nor access it. It's very similar to the problem I'm seeing in Visual Studio. It's rather random. I'm downloading another file at this very same moment to the exact same directory and it's downloading just fine.
- Slight error with CCleaner: CCleaner requires the file wer.dll and when it launches it displays an error message saying that it is unable to locate this file. I believe this file has something to do with Windows Error Reporting. It is deleted with VLite in the default settings file. Sure it could possibly be fixed by un-checking Windows Error Reporting in VLite. CCleaner works just fine without this DLL, though.
- iPhone issue - The driver for charging an iPhone is apparently removed when using the 7elite version as well. I mounted the original image and was able to locate a driver from it, however, I was unable to install it. I did not have time to track down the exact issue, but I do know that the driver I needed was removed from the image created using the 7elite guide.

Also, I need to clarify that the permission/locking problem occurs after UAC has been enabled. I have not tested it without UAC.

@ EneergE: For iPhone driver, i know that it is the vLite component "Windows Portable Devices" in Hardware Support.

Just deselect it, so it does not get removed. That fixed the problem for me.
